i've the problem that i have very long response times for parallel printing. it's a hp deskjet 1200c managed by cups. if i send a job the online led begins flashing after maybe 30 seconds. first page is printing after some minutes, the next page is printing after some minutes, then the next page after some minutes and so on.

i've tried different ppd including the recommended foomatic ppd.

I'll try to help, but, you didn't give much information.


Are you trying to print to a parallel port attached to the workstation or the server ? Are you using graphics printing or text printing? Even if just printing text, is CUPS translating the print job to graphics? It sounds like you are printing in graphics mode, and the printer is doing what is expected (not a very fast printer).

From HP's website, the print speeds for HP Deskjet 1200C are:

TEXT
* 7 pages per minute, fast mode
* 6 pages per minute, normal mode
* 4 pages per minute, high quality mode

GRAPHICS
* 1 minutes per page, fast mode
* 2 minutes per page, high quality mode
* 3 minutes per page, transparencies
